Analytics Summary
BC.Game Esports are overwhelming favorites in this Bo1 against ROUNDS, and the data strongly supports that assessment. The API's recent form showing 1W-9L for BC.Game reflects their previous roster (the SAW core of MUTiRiS, krazy, aragornN), which was replaced in June-July 2026. The current BC.Game lineup — s1mple (1.29 rating, 84.37 ADR, 1.40 K/D), electroNic (1.14), Magisk (Emil Reif, joined June 30), Senzu (1.15), and mzinho (joined July 9) — represents one of the most star-studded rosters in the European scene. The Thunderpick odds of 1.04 for BC.Game (implying ~96% win probability) reflect this reality.
ROUNDS are a Finnish mid-tier team with a 4W-6L recent record and modest individual stats. Their best performer ykis rates at 1.03, with Monoxx at 1.00 and Jelo at 0.96. The team's career record of 32W-83L (27.8%) underscores their status as a significant underdog. In a Bo1 format, upsets are always possible, but the talent gap between a s1mple-led BC.Game and ROUNDS is among the largest you'll see at this level. Note that ROUNDS underwent a roster change in late June 2026 (Jelo departed June 26, Lapa joined July 3), adding some uncertainty to their current form.
There is no head-to-head history between these teams. The analysis is straightforward: BC.Game's individual star power — particularly s1mple's 1.29 rating and 1.40 K/D — is simply too much for ROUNDS to handle in a single-map format. We predict BC.Game Esports with 82% confidence, acknowledging the inherent variance of a Bo1.
